Asbestos roof removal regulations and guidelines are essential for guaranteeing the protection of workers and the common public. Asbestos, a naturally occurring mineral as quickly as extensively used in construction, poses significant health risks. When disturbed, it could possibly launch dangerous fibers into the air, leading to serious respiratory diseases, together with asbestosis and mesothelioma.


When dealing with asbestos, it is vital to grasp the regulatory framework surrounding its removal. Various health and security businesses have established guidelines to mitigate risks related to asbestos exposure. These regulations usually differ by region, so understanding the local legal guidelines is crucial for compliance.


Before beginning any asbestos roof removal project, a thorough inspection is important. Qualified professionals should conduct these inspections to find out the presence and situation of asbestos-containing materials. Safe Asbestos Removal Sydney. Any recognized asbestos ought to be further assessed to resolve the most secure removal technique.

Proper training is one other important element within the asbestos removal process. Workers should be adequately trained to handle asbestos safely and successfully. This contains understanding the dangers, using the proper protective tools, and figuring out the proper procedures for disposing of asbestos materials.


In most regions, particular licensing is required for contractors conducting asbestos removal. These corporations must adhere to strict guidelines and reveal their capability to perform protected removals. The licensing process usually consists of offering proof of training, compliance with safety regulations, and typically, previous expertise in handling asbestos.


During the planning section, it’s essential to develop a comprehensive removal plan. This plan ought to outline the methods for use, the timeline, and the required safety measures. It should also specify how to talk with related stakeholders, together with native authorities and the encompassing neighborhood.


Notification can also be required before the removal work begins. This may involve informing local health departments or different regulatory bodies to make sure they are aware of the dangers and preventive measures being carried out. Effective communication with residents residing nearby can be advisable to minimize panic and make certain that they are knowledgeable about potential risks.

On-site safety measures are crucial in the course of the removal operation - Sydney Asbestos Roof Disposal Services. Workers should put on acceptable private protective equipment, including respirators and protecting fits. Environmental controls, similar to using negative air stress models, might help prevent fibers from spreading past the designated work space.


Waste disposal procedures also fall under strict regulations. Asbestos waste should be sealed in leak-proof containers and labeled appropriately. Transporting this waste requires adherence to particular guidelines to prevent publicity all through the journey to approved disposal sites.


Post-removal procedures are equally necessary to guarantee that the realm is free from asbestos fibers. Air monitoring could additionally be needed to confirm that air high quality meets safety requirements earlier than allowing occupancy again. Additionally, thorough cleansing of the location must be performed to get rid of any residual asbestos fibers.

  • Asbestos roof removal should be carried out by licensed professionals who are skilled in dealing with hazardous materials to ensure security and compliance with regulations.

  • Homeowners are required to provide notification to local authorities before commencing any asbestos removal actions, usually no much less than 10 days upfront.

  • Personal protecting gear (PPE) is mandatory for workers concerned in asbestos removal, together with respirators, disposable coveralls, and gloves to attenuate exposure.

  • Waste generated from asbestos removal is classed as hazardous and should be transported and disposed of at accredited facilities specializing in dealing with asbestos materials.

  • Ventilation should be managed through the removal process to stop airborne asbestos fibers from spreading to adjoining areas.

  • Asbestos removal should be carried out in accordance with specific environmental regulations, which may embrace local, state, and federal guidelines corresponding to these enforced by the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A).

  • Documentation of the removal course of, including evaluation reports and disposal receipts, ought to be maintained for potential future inquiries or inspections.

  • Immediate cleanup of any debris must happen to attenuate exposure risk, employing moist methods to dampen materials and cut back dust.

  • It is essential to observe post-removal inspection protocols to guarantee that no residual asbestos stays in the area accessible to occupants.
